Why is this the correct answer?

In a low liquidity environment, there aren’t enough participants to absorb buy or sell orders smoothly. When a large order hits the market, it can move prices drastically because there aren’t many orders on the other side to balance it. For beginners, understanding liquidity helps explain why thin markets can see exaggerated swings during news events or large trades.
